Bad Genius: The Series - Season 1

Season 1

Episodes

Episode 1
Lynn is offered a scholarship to attend a prestigious school after winning a Scrabble tournament. However, after enrolling in the school, she learns that her father did not reveal the financial burden the change has put on their family. As one of the brightest students in the class, Lynn is approached by Pat to help him cheat in exchange for financial compensation.

Episode 2
Lynn and Bank enter a fierce competition between each other over a coveted scholarship.

Episode 3
Grace and Claire battle it out over the school's Cinderella auditions. Questions arise when another student is caught cheating during an exam.

Episode 4
Grace and Pat's relationship isn't as sweet as before. Pat starts to notice that Grace is distancing herself from him. At the same time, Lin decides to cheat the exams for the last time. Also, she has a new answer-passing trick which allows her to distribute the answers to the whole class and beyond. However, this trick takes a turn when someone finds out about this exam-cheating operation.

Episode 5
Bank is very disappointed when he finds out that Lin was the one who gave away the answers. The flourishing relationship between them is now ruined. Meanwhile, the headmistress calls Lin and Bank in to find out who is the mastermind of the exam-cheating operation. The relationship between Pat and Grace also goes down the hill because Pat figures out why Grace is not the same anymore.

Episode 6
Lin becomes a tutor working with an agent named Music. But it isn't enough money. However, Lin figures out another plan to earn more money. Music then suggests that Lin take STIC exams for other people, since the pay is very high. Lin then asks Pat and Grace to join this STIC exam cheating mission together.

Episode 7
Bank's family is in crisis when his laundry shop gets broken into and completely trashed to pieces. Bank wants to find out who would want to do this to him. Since he needs a lot of money to help his mother, he decides to join Lin, Pat, and Grace in the STIC plan for money. At the same time, from evidence that Lin has left at home, her parent's suspect something is wrong.

Episode 8
Lin and Bank are taking the STIC exam in Australia. However, when it's time for Bank to send his part of answers back to Thailand, Bank threatens not to do so unless Pat and Grace transfer him another 500,000 baht. With time closing in on them, this mission runs into a bigger obstacle which becomes a turning point for both Lin's and Bank's life.

Episode 9
Although Lin decides to move to Australia to live with her mother as well as study there, this exam-cheating mission hasn't come to an end. Bank begs Lin to cheat on the national level entrance exams with him in order to earn over 10 million baht. At that moment, Pat has a falling out with his family and enticing him to join the exam cheating operation again.

Episode 10
Lin unwillingly agrees to join and helps plan for this national level exam-cheating mission. Having Ms Music as their agent to find over 800 clients, this mission and their plan are much riskier since it involves more than just the four of them, unlike what they have been doing before.

Episode 11
Their plan does not go as smoothly as expected and raises suspicion among other people. The tension and pressure build up to the point that it makes Bank choose a path that might cause him to fall out with the team.

Episode 12
Bank can't commit to what he's initially agreed with the team. On top of that, Lin, Pat and Grace find out about the secret that Bank has kept from them. Their relationship has come to an end. What would the conclusion of these four be? This cheating exam mission has not only changed their lives, but it also affects their relationships, which will forever change everything too.

The Floor
The Floor is a physical quiz show that sees 81 contestants face off in quiz duels on a giant LED floor divided into a 9×9 grid of squares, each representing its own field of knowledge.
The first challenger, selected at random, must choose one of his or her neighboring opponents to go head-to-head in an epic quiz duel in the opponent's category. The winner takes over the loser's square, gaining valuable ground as they expand their territory, while the loser exits the game. The winner must then choose – do they continue on and attempt to secure another square? Or do they let The Floor choose a new challenger? The last contestant standing who gains full control over The Floor takes home a life-changing $250,000 cash prize.
